Mountain Bike Riding (Specialised Activity)

LOCATION:
Off-site: Lilydale – Warburton Rail Trail

DESCRIPTION:
Mountain bike riding is a team activity where campers can challenge their own skills while enjoying
the surrounding setting of Warburton Trail. This activity can be run on-site however in a limited area.
If this activity is off-site, care needs to be taken while travelling to the location.

AGE SUSTAINABILITY:
Year 7 and above.

RATIOS:
The activities ratios and qualifications have been taken from the Victorian Education Department
Cycling guidelines and the AAS for Cycling.

ACTIVITY STAFFING:
ADANAC Program staff have to run this activity because it is a specialised activity. If participant
numbers grow the user group may have to deliver extra staff to cover the activity ratio.

LEADER REQUIRED EXPERIENCE:


Leaders of this activity do not need previous experience in Mountain Bike Riding, however recent
experience with Mountain Bike equipment is preferable.
ASSISTANT REQUIRED EXPERIENCE:
No previous experience needed by the assistant.

PARTICIPANT REQUIRED EXPERIENCE:


Students should not be taken off-site until they can:
- Demonstrate an adequate understanding of the likely traffic conditions
- Demonstrate the ability to respond appropriately to potential hazards
- Develop and cognitive skills to manage the road traffic environment safely as a cyclist.

TEACHER INSTRUCTIONS:
ADANAC program staff are to explain safety precautions to the student’s on-site before travelling to
the Warburton Rail Trail. Before biking through the bike trail off-site, staff and students need to be
wary of motor vehicles while crossing to the Warburton Rail Trail. Also, ADANAC program staff are to
explain safety of riding behind students in a singular riding line. ADANAC program staff are to also
explain the mountain bike equipment and how to use them on the bike trail.
